التأكد من وجود بيئة برمجية جاهزة (Node.js, Python, PHP, C#)

التأكد من وجود بيئة برمجية جاهزة (Node.js, Python, PHP, C#)

قبل البدء في استخدام واجهة برمجة التطبيقات (API) الخاصة بواتس 360، من الضروري التأكد من أن بيئتك البرمجية جاهزة للعمل. في هذا المقال، سنشرح كيفية إعداد بيئة برمجية تدعم اللغات التالية: Node.js، Python، PHP، وC#. هذه اللغات هي الأكثر شيوعًا لتنفيذ طلبات HTTP والتعامل مع APIs.

1. إعداد بيئة Node.js

Node.js هي بيئة تشغيل تعتمد على JavaScript وتستخدم على نطاق واسع لتنفيذ تطبيقات الخادم (Server-side).

خطوات التثبيت:

  1. قم بزيارة الموقع الرسمي لـ Node.js.
  2. قم بتنزيل الإصدار المناسب لنظام التشغيل الخاص بك (يفضل الإصدار LTS).
  3. قم بتثبيت Node.js باستخدام المثبت (Installer).
  4. افتح terminal أو command prompt وتحقق من التثبيت باستخدام الأمر التالي:
    node -v

    إذا ظهر رقم الإصدار، فإن التثبيت ناجح.

تثبيت مكتبة node-fetch:

لإرسال طلبات HTTP في Node.js، يمكنك استخدام مكتبة node-fetch. قم بتثبيتها باستخدام الأمر التالي:

npm install node-fetch

2. إعداد بيئة Python

Python هي لغة برمجة قوية وسهلة التعلم، وتستخدم على نطاق واسع في تطوير الويب والتعامل مع APIs.

خطوات التثبيت:

  1. قم بزيارة الموقع الرسمي لـ Python.
  2. قم بتنزيل الإصدار المناسب لنظام التشغيل الخاص بك (يفضل الإصدار 3.x).
  3. قم بتثبيت Python باستخدام المثبت (Installer).
  4. افتح terminal أو command prompt وتحقق من التثبيت باستخدام الأمر التالي:
    python --version

    إذا ظهر رقم الإصدار، فإن التثبيت ناجح.

تثبيت مكتبة requests:

لإرسال طلبات HTTP في Python، يمكنك استخدام مكتبة requests. قم بتثبيتها باستخدام الأمر التالي:

pip install requests

3. إعداد بيئة PHP

PHP هي لغة برمجة شائعة الاستخدام في تطوير الويب، وتدعم إرسال طلبات HTTP بسهولة.

خطوات التثبيت:

  1. قم بزيارة الموقع الرسمي لـ PHP.
  2. قم بتنزيل الإصدار المناسب لنظام التشغيل الخاص بك.
  3. قم بتثبيت PHP باستخدام المثبت (Installer).
  4. افتح terminal أو command prompt وتحقق من التثبيت باستخدام الأمر التالي:
    php -v

    إذا ظهر رقم الإصدار، فإن التثبيت ناجح.

تمكين مكتبة cURL:

لإرسال طلبات HTTP في PHP، يمكنك استخدام مكتبة cURL. تأكد من تمكينها في ملف php.ini:

extension=curl

4. إعداد بيئة C#

C# هي لغة برمجة قوية وتستخدم بشكل واسع في تطوير تطبيقات الويب والبرامج باستخدام إطار عمل .NET.

خطوات التثبيت:

  1. قم بزيارة الموقع الرسمي لـ .NET.
  2. قم بتنزيل وتثبيت .NET SDK.
  3. افتح terminal أو command prompt وتحقق من التثبيت باستخدام الأمر التالي:
    dotnet --version

    إذا ظهر رقم الإصدار، فإن التثبيت ناجح.

إنشاء مشروع جديد:

لإنشاء مشروع جديد في C#، استخدم الأمر التالي:

dotnet new console -o MyProject

اختبار البيئة البرمجية

بعد إعداد البيئة البرمجية، يمكنك اختبارها عن طريق تنفيذ أكواد بسيطة لإرسال طلبات HTTP. إليك مثال باستخدام Node.js:


const fetch = require('node-fetch');

async function testRequest() {
    const url = 'https://jsonplaceholder.typicode.com/posts/1';
    try {
        const response = await fetch(url);
        const data = await response.json();
        console.log('Response:', data);
    } catch (error) {
        console.error('Error:', error);
    }
}

testRequest();
    

الكلمات المفتاحية المناسبة

  • إعداد بيئة برمجية
  • Node.js
  • Python
  • PHP
  • C#
  • واتس 360 API
  • إرسال طلبات HTTP
  • تثبيت Node.js
  • تثبيت Python
  • تثبيت PHP
  • تثبيت .NET SDK
  • مكتبة node-fetch
  • مكتبة requests
  • مكتبة cURL

الخلاصة

التأكد من وجود بيئة برمجية جاهزة هو الخطوة الأولى لبدء استخدام واجهة برمجة التطبيقات (API) الخاصة بواتس 360. سواء كنت تستخدم Node.js، Python، PHP، أو C#، فإن إعداد البيئة بشكل صحيح يضمن لك تنفيذ الأكواد بسلاسة وفعالية.

ابدأ بإعداد بيئتك البرمجية اليوم واستخدم واتس 360 API لإرسال رسائل واتساب برمجيًا وتحسين تجربة عملائك.

حقوق النشر © واتس 360 whats360 وتساب API 2025 | الإصدار: 4.9.0


Leave a comment

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ها بـ *